Transaction 30f24f9396e578ff86c3d5316f7c11b03b3a36e994ca1e1f88c7724c9c3c110f

1 Input
2 Outputs
  • 30f24f9396e578ff86c3d5316f7c11b03b3a36e994ca1e1f88c7724c9c3c110f:0
  • value  169596125
    address  mwhtphULTaaLaXv7Gnr2RgvgFaQD6EVThx
  • 30f24f9396e578ff86c3d5316f7c11b03b3a36e994ca1e1f88c7724c9c3c110f:1
  • value  25100
    address  moBexQ4KjwwMFkAjCc7HPhpXpPAAjrUMeL